Xianghui Su is a scholar working on Surgery,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Xianghui Su has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 333 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Surgery, 7 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 4 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Xianghui Su's work include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(8 papers), Diabetes and associated disorders (4 papers) and Diabetes Treatment and Management (4 papers). Xianghui Su is often cited by papers focused on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(8 papers), Diabetes and associated disorders (4 papers) and Diabetes Treatment and Management (4 papers). Xianghui Su collaborates with scholars based in China and United States. Xianghui Su's co-authors include Xuefeng Yu, Xi Chen, Xiangyun Chang, Jinfang Sun, Xiangyun Zhu, Jianjiang Lu, Zhelong Liu, Liegang Liu, Shiying Shao and Xinrong Zhou and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ism and Scientific Reports.
